show logging
Displays system logging messages by log file, process-names, or summary.
Syntax
show logging {log-file [process-name | line-numbers] | process-names}
Parameters
process-name (Optional) Enter the process-name to use as a filter in syslog messages.
line-numbers (Optional) Enter the number of lines to include in the logging messages, from 1 to
65535.
Default None
Command Mode EXEC
Usage
Information
The output from this command is the /var/log/eventlog file.
Supported on the MX9116n and MX5108n switches in Full Switch mode starting in release 10.4.0E(R3S).
Also supported in SmartFabric mode starting in release 10.5.0.1.
Example (Log
File)
OS10# show logging log-file process-name dn_qos

show trace
Displays trace messages.
Syntax
show trace [number-lines]
Parameters number-lines (Optional) Enter the number of lines to include in log messages, from 1 to 65535.
Default Enabled
Command Mode EXEC
